Bruno Grazioli 681536c8c7 Added Disk Capacity in cluster-data-model
Fetched information of total disk capacity from nova and added a new
resource 'disk_capacity' to NovaClusterModelCollector cluster. Also a
new resource type 'disk_capacity' was added to ResourceType.

from enum import Enum
class ResourceType(Enum):
cpu_cores = 'num_cores'
memory = 'memory'
disk = 'disk'
disk_capacity = 'disk_capacity'
class Resource(object):
def __init__(self, name, capacity=None):
"""Resource
:param name: ResourceType
:param capacity: max
:return:
"""
self._name = name
self.capacity = capacity
self.mapping = {}
@property
def name(self):
return self._name
@name.setter
def name(self, n):
self._name = n
def set_capacity(self, element, value):
self.mapping[element.uuid] = value
def get_capacity_from_id(self, uuid):
if str(uuid) in self.mapping.keys():
return self.mapping[str(uuid)]
else:
# TODO(jed) throw exception
return None
def get_capacity(self, element):
return self.get_capacity_from_id(element.uuid)
